15th Edition of Abu Dhabi World Professional Jiu-Jitsu Championship Concludes with UAE Success

The curtain fell this evening on the competitions of the 15th edition of the Abu Dhabi World Professional Jiu-Jitsu Championship. Sheikh Khalifa bin Tahnoun bin Mohammed Al Nahyan, Head of the Court of the Crown Prince of Abu Dhabi, attended the competitions and crowned the winners. The UAE champions succeeded in winning 8 colored medals in professional competitions, including two gold, four silver, and two bronze.

Khaled Al Shehhi succeeded in achieving a valuable silver in the 62 kg weight, after keeping up with his experienced Brazilian opponent, Miran Alves, for most of the fight, but the experience factor was in favor of the Brazilian, who decided the fight and achieved the gold.

Emirati Zayed Al Kathiri also succeeded in achieving silver in the 56 kg weight category after an equal fight with Brazilian Yuri Hendricks, who achieved gold.
The closing day of the tournament was attended by Sheikh Hamdan bin Sultan bin Hamdan Al Nahyan, Sheikh Tariq bin Faisal Al Qasimi, Abdul Moneim Al Sayed Mohammed Al Hashimi, President of the Emirati and Asian Federations, First Vice President of the International Jiu-Jitsu Federation, and a number of officials.

With the conclusion of the professional competitions in the 15th edition of the Abu Dhabi World Professional Jiu-Jitsu Championship, the players of the UAE’s Commando Group Academy were able to take the lead, and the players of the UAE’s AFNT Academy also came in runner-up, and the American “Checkmat International” Academy came in third place.

As for the results of the black belt finals, the gold in the 69 kg category went to the Brazilian Raimundo Sodre, and the Portuguese Pedro Ramalho snatched the gold in the 77 kg category. Portuguese Bruno Lima also won gold in the 85 kg category. Brazilian Felipe Andrew Silva scored a strong victory and won the 94 kg gold medal. The last fight witnessed the victory of Brazilian Felipe Bezerra over Russian Anton Seleznev, winning gold in the 120 kg category.

In the women’s fights, Brazilian Maisa Caldas Pereira Bastos won gold in the 49 kg weight, Brazilian Ana Rodriguez won gold in the 55 kg weight, Brazilian Julia Alves won gold in the 62 kg weight, Brazilian Ingrid Sosa won gold in the 70 kg weight, and Gabriele Pisagna also won gold in the 95 kg weight category. .
